Spezifikationen

Attribut Wert
PartStatus Active
AmplifierType Standard
NumberofCircuits 1
OutputType Rail-to-Rail
SlewRate 0.7V/µs
Current-InputBias 27 nA
Voltage-InputOffset 1 mV
Current-Supply 130µA
Current-Output/Channel 70 mA
Voltage-SupplySpan(Min) 2.7 V
Voltage-SupplySpan(Max) 5.5 V
OperatingTemperature -40°C ~ 125°C
MountingType Surface Mount
Package/Case 5-TSSOP, SC-70-5, SOT-353
SupplierDevicePackage SC-70-5
BaseProductNumber LMV321
GainBandwidthProduct 1.3 MHz

Description

The LMV321LICT is a general-purpose, single-channel operational amplifier (op-amp) known for its low voltage, low power consumption, and wide bandwidth. It is part of the LMV321 series, which is designed to operate on supply voltages as low as 2.7V, making it ideal for battery-powered applications. The device is characterized by its rail-to-rail input and output capability, allowing for maximum signal swing and efficient use in low-voltage systems.
Typical applications for the LMV321LICT include signal conditioning, active filtering, and general-purpose amplification in consumer electronics, portable devices, and industrial equipment. The op-amp provides a good balance between performance and power efficiency, with a slew rate that supports moderate-speed signal processing.
Packaged in a compact SOT-23 form factor, the LMV321LICT is easy to integrate into a variety of circuit designs where space is a constraint. Its robust design ensures reliable performance across a range of operating conditions, making it a versatile choice for engineers and designers working on both analog and digital systems.

Pinout

The LMV321LICT is a single-channel operational amplifier (op-amp) that typically comes in a SOT-23-5 package, which includes 5 pins. Here’s a brief overview of the pin functions:
1. Inverting Input (V- or IN-): This pin is used to apply the input voltage that you want to invert or compare to the non-inverting input.
2. Non-Inverting Input (V+ or IN+): This pin receives the input voltage for non-inversion or comparison with the inverting input.
3. Output (OUT): This pin provides the amplified signal from the op-amp.
4. VCC (Positive Supply Voltage): This pin is connected to the positive supply voltage, powering the op-amp.
5. GND (Ground or Negative Supply Voltage): This pin is connected to the ground or the negative supply voltage if a dual supply is used.
The LMV321 op-amp is commonly used in various applications, including signal conditioning, filtering, and amplification, due to its low power consumption and adequate performance for general-purpose tasks.
